Block Index Volume 1Page 21 is a good example of the type of information in all the Encyclopedia of Patchwork Blocks books.

Pieced Star can be made in four block sizes with Set A and four more sizes with Set B, from 4 1/4" to 16" (12" size is made with Set A). Templates are keyed by number in the boxed area. An exploded block diagram illustrates construction.

The block is repeated, arranged and colored in different ways to spark your ideas—or use ours! You can photocopy the blank grids and try out different colorations.

Many pages feature "Design Tips." In this case, it is suggested that you try combining two blocks with the same basic grid (like 4 units across and 4 down) to create new quilt designs.
